Your Mission

As a Primary Care Paramedic, you are the frontline provider of emergency medical care, delivering rapid, professional response in critical situations. This role ensures patient safety and comfort while adhering to provincial standards and organizational protocols. You’ll maintain readiness of equipment and vehicles, perform triage and medical retrievals, and provide care within your licensed scope of practice. With responsibilities spanning accurate documentation, infection control, and participation in ongoing training and quality improvement, this position demands clinical expertise, adaptability, and a commitment to excellence in every emergency scenario.

How to prepare for a job interview at International SOS

✨Know Your Stuff

Make sure you brush up on your knowledge of emergency medical care and the specific protocols used by International SOS. Familiarise yourself with their mission and values, as well as any recent news or developments in the company. This will show that you're genuinely interested and prepared.

✨Showcase Your Experience

Be ready to discuss your previous work as a Primary Care Paramedic. Prepare specific examples of how you've handled critical situations, collaborated with teams, and maintained equipment readiness. Use the STAR method (Situation, Task, Action, Result) to structure your answers effectively.

✨Demonstrate Your Soft Skills

In this role, compassion and teamwork are key. Be prepared to share instances where you've worked under pressure or resolved conflicts within a team. Highlight your ability to communicate clearly and empathetically with patients and colleagues alike.

✨Ask Thoughtful Questions

At the end of the interview, have a few questions ready that show your interest in the role and the company. You might ask about ongoing training opportunities, how they support work-life balance, or what a typical day looks like for a Primary Care Paramedic at International SOS. This not only shows your enthusiasm but also helps you gauge if the role is right for you.
